Ex Factor 2.0 works by replacing emotional reactions with a structured, psychology-based system. The program is built on several interlocking principles:
| Phase | Goal | What You Do |
|---|---|---|
| 1. Analyze the Breakup | Understand what happened | Identify negative associations and relationship patterns |
| 2. No-Contact Period | Create emotional space | Implement strategic cooling-off when appropriate |
| 3. Self-Improvement | Rebuild confidence | Work on emotional regulation, communication, and self-worth |
| 4. Rebuild Attraction | Shift emotional associations | Use communication psychology and behavioral cues |
| 5. Reconnect | Re-engage strategically | Follow scripts and timing guidance for contact |
The program leverages concepts from attachment theory, cognitive-behavioral therapy principles, emotional intelligence, and communication psychology. It is not presented as a quick fix; consistent application and genuine self-reflection are required.
